Saint Bernard
A massive, gentle rescue dog from the Swiss Alps with a heart as big as its body. Saint Bernards are patient, friendly, and wonderful with children despite their enormous size.
Anatolian Shepherd
A massive, powerful livestock guardian with roots in ancient Turkey. Anatolian Shepherds are fiercely territorial and independent, built to protect flocks from predators without human direction.
Black Russian Terrier
A massive, Soviet-bred working dog designed for guarding and military work. Black Russian Terriers are confident, calm, and highly intelligent, combining power with a dignified, protective temperament.
Beagle
Merry, curious, and always following their nose, Beagles are compact hounds with big personalities. They are wonderful family dogs who get along well with kids and other pets.
Basset Hound
Droopy-eyed, long-eared, and impossibly charming, the Basset Hound is a low-key companion with one of the best noses in the dog world. They are patient, gentle, and stubbornly lovable.
Bloodhound
The world's greatest tracking dog with a nose that can follow a scent trail for miles. Bloodhounds are gentle, patient, and deeply affectionate but incredibly stubborn when on a trail.
Great Dane
The gentle giant of the dog world, Great Danes combine massive size with a sweet, patient temperament. Despite standing up to 32 inches tall, they are affectionate couch companions at heart.
Newfoundland
A sweet-natured giant bred for water rescue, the Newfoundland is often called a 'nanny dog' for their exceptional gentleness with children. They are strong swimmers and devoted family protectors.
